[PATCH] auxdisplay: hd44780: Fix potential memory leak in hd44780_remove()
Posted by Jianglei Nie 3 years, 9 months ago
hd44780_probe() allocates a memory chunk for hd with kzalloc() and
makes "lcd->drvdata->hd44780" point to it. When we call hd44780_remove(),
we should release all relevant memory and resource, but "lcd->drvdata
->hd44780" is not released, which will lead to a memory leak.

We should release the "lcd->drvdata->hd44780" in hd44780_remove() to fix
the memory leak bug.

diff --git a/drivers/auxdisplay/hd44780.c b/drivers/auxdisplay/hd44780.c
index 8b2a0eb3f32a..8940a93d2d4d 100644
--- a/drivers/auxdisplay/hd44780.c
+++ b/drivers/auxdisplay/hd44780.c
@@ -324,6 +324,7 @@ static int hd44780_remove(struct platform_device *pdev)
 	struct charlcd *lcd = platform_get_drvdata(pdev);
 
 	charlcd_unregister(lcd);
+	kfree(lcd->drvdata->hd44780);
 	kfree(lcd->drvdata);
 
 	kfree(lcd);
